| Abstract/Notes | In the title compound, [Fe(C5H5)(C23H22N2)]PF6, the F atoms of the [PF6]− anion are disordered over four different orientations with equal occupancies. In the cation, the five-membered imidazolium ring forms dihedral angles of 71.48 (10) and 19.83 (10)° with the substituted C5H4 ring and the benzene ring of the styryl group, respectively. In the crystal structure, there is a significant C—H...π(η5-C5H4) interaction. | ||
